pegun1 said:
:D she will stand lovely but getting her to walk straight and not think we are strangling her is another matter  :p
Let her go on a loose lead and just use voice and titbits to encourage her. At our ringcraft we train all breeds to go like this, dogs off leads as well, so that you cannot 'string them up'. Plenty of time for her to learn to go in a controlled manner with contact through the lead once they have learnt what is actually required of them. A lot of the time it is not the dog that is the problem but the handler being nervous or not knowing what they are doing!!!
